¼ Dollar "Washington Quarter" (District of Columbia - Silver Proof)
Country: United States
Denomination: Quarter Dollar = 25 Cents
(0.25 USD)
Year: 2009
Material: Silver (.900)
Weight: 6.25 g
Shape: Round
Diameter: 24.26 mm
Type: Non circulating coin
Catalog list: united states
Description:
Obverse
The portrait in left profile of George Washington, the first President of the United States from 1789 to 1797, is accompanied with the motto "IN GOD WE TRUST" and the lettering "LIBERTY" surrounded with the denomination and the inscription "UNITED STATES OF AMERICA"
Reverse
Features native son Duke Ellington, the internationally renowned composer and musician, seated at a grand piano with the inscriptions, DISTRICT OF COLUMBIA, DUKE ELLINGTON and JUSTICE FOR ALL, the District's motto.
